Now for the longer answer lol:
For modern pop songs, there's no better place to start than Ram Pam Pam by BESS. The song has become a bit of a Eurovision darling despite the fact that it lost in the Finnish Eurovision national final, the UMK, and thus didn't compete in 2022. The song bears influence of Finnish pop and schlager (in Finnish this genre is called "iskelmä") artist Kaija Koo's songs, which tend to have empowering messages. If you want to listen to Kaija Koo's music, I'd recommend the songs Tinakenkätyttö, Kaunis rietas onnellinen, and Supernaiset.
A song that I have a personal soft spot for is the 80's summer banger Lähtisitkö by Pave Maijanen. It's a corny love song, but that's exactly why it's so great. 🥰 While we're on the topic love songs, there's also Hei Rakas by BEHM, which has very sweet and genuine lyrics and absolutely gorgeous instrumentals. (As a side note, this song is somewhat connected to Eurovision as well, as BEHM performed the song live during UMK 2020 as an interval act).
If you're interested in pop songs that use traditional Finnish instruments in them, I'd recommend both Soutaa Huopaa and Saatilla by the band Elokuu. These songs mix traditional Finnish instruments and the traditional Finnish dance music genre humppa (similar to waltz and foxtrot music) with Finnish schlager music and rap. In that sense, these songs are somewhat similar to Käärijä's Cha Cha Cha, as they mix schlager with rap, though the vibes are completely different. 😂 There's also Henkilökohtaisesti by PMMP, which uses a mix of traditional Finnish instruments and modern genres. As a matter of fact, I'd recommend the entirety of PMMP's album Leskiäidin Tyttäret, where Henkilökohtaisesti is included, as well as another album called Kovemmat Kädet. Though as a fair warning, many of the songs on these albums touch on very heavy topics. There's also the band Lauri Tähkä & Elonkerjuu, which blended traditional folk elements with schlager and rock. Their lyrics also utilise the Finnish Pohjanmaa dialect, adding onto the folk -feel of their music. Most of their songs are love songs, my personal favourites from their catalogue are Pauhaava sydän, Hetkeksi en sulle rupia, and Suudellaan. There's also the song Marmoritaivas by Johanna Kurkela, another very beautiful love song with some more traditional sounding elements to it. Fun fact about Johanna, she's also an ex UMK contestant who didn't make it to Eurovision! Moreover, Suru on kunniavieras by Jenni Vartiainen doesn't necessarily use any traditional instruments, but resembles old Finnish music in terms of specific vocals and some of the lyrics.
Of course I also have to bring up Finnish metal and rock music. Some of my personal favourite metal songs in Finnish are Hengitä by Turmion Kätilöt (who tend to have quite... interesting lyrics), Laiva by Merta and Syvyydet by Vorna. Hengitä and Laiva are both songs about mental illness. For less heavy music, there are the likes of Happoradio and Uniklubi, for specifically all-female acts there are Tiktak and Indica. As a starting point for these bands, I'd recommend Che Guevara by Happoradio, Kaikki mitä mä annoin by Uniklubi, Samantekevää by Tiktak (fun fact this was my absolute favourite song as a kid) and Ikuinen Virta by Indica. I feel slightly obligated to also recommend the songs Joutsenlaulu by Yö and Armo by Apulanta, as both are arguably culturally significant songs. Joutsenlaulu is a reflection on mortality and a song about loss (playing into the typical Finnish artist's obsession with death as an artistic motif), while Armo could be interpreted as a song about the Winter War (a war between the Soviet Union and Finland that took place during the World War II and has shaped Finnish culture immensely). There's also a very beautiful choir cover of the song Armo, called Konflikti (Armo). This version was featured in a movie about Apulanta. Sadly, Joutsenlaulu is not available on Spotify anymore (or any other streaming services for that matter). Funnily enough, Joutsenlaulu was originally meant to be a candidate for the Eurovision song contest of 1984, but the idea was scrapped after its composer came to the realisation that he couldn't possibly keep the length of the song under three minutes. Hey anon, sorry for the late reply! 💕
Let me preface this by saying that since the Finnish language doesn’t have gendered personal pronouns, a lot of songs are open for interpretation when it comes to gender and sexuality! So, I opted to go for some songs that are very clearly queer coded, and also to give you a few examples Finnish artists who are part of the LGBTQ community!

First off, I think it’s essential to start with the Finnish lesbian anthem: ”Ihmisten edessä” by Jenni Vartiainen. This song is really important for many people my age, as it was pretty much ”Baby’s first exposure to non-het relationships” to a lot of people. The song is an absolute banger, and, fun fact, was written and composed by Teemu Brunila, who is believed to be the voice behind Studio Killers’ singer Cherry. Thus it’s likely that he may even have been involved in the creation of Jenny, which is another lesbian anthem.
Then we have our UMK contestants who didn’t quite make it to the Eurovision like Benjamin who competed with the song ”Hoida Mut” in 2023, Isaac Sene who competed with the song ”Kuuma jäbä” in 2022, and Erika Vikman, who competed in 2020 with the song ”Cicciolina”. Out of these three, Hoida Mut and Kuuma jäbä make it obvious that they’re about gay relationships, while Cicciolina is open for interpretation (which may be because Erika is bisexual). Of course, there is also Saara Aalto, who competed in the Eurovision song contest in 2018 with ”Monsters”.  Out of her songs that are in Finnish, I personally like the song ”Tähdet, taivas ja sä” the most.
One of my favourite Finnish LGBTQ artists is SANNI. Some of my favourite songs by her are 2080-luvulla, Hei kevät, and Pornoo.
The singer Siiri Nordin is also LGBTQ. Her cover of the song "Something's Gotten Hold of My Heart”, called ”Sydämeni osuman sai” is very lovely.
I can’t say I’m super familiar with the career of Sini Yasemin, however she is an emerging LGBTQ artist whose work is also worth looking into! Her cover of Rakkautta ja piikkilankaa (originally performed by the rock group Uniklubi) is probably a safe place to start if you want to get a grasp of her sound.
